Tillingham Wine

Nestled in a secluded corner of the Sussex countryside, Tillingham Winery crafts natural, biodynamic wines that has earned them an established reputation within the natural wine scene.

Minimally intervened, these wines are a testament to the English countryside, delivering a taste that truly reflects the land's unique character.

Tillingham winery champions traditional practices at the heart of the valley. Farming in conjunction with biodynamics, their practices aim to produce delicious wine, whilst bringing the land back to its full potential, fostering a diverse ecosystem. 

Tillingham focuses on producing natural wines. This means they use minimal intervention during the winemaking process, relying on organic practices in the vineyard reflects the land's unique character.

Unique to its name, Tillingham winery produces some field blend wines which combine multiple grape varieties grown together in the same vineyard. This brings out the unique characteristics of each grape contributing to the final flavour profile.

At Tillingham, they utilise a variety of grape varietals, including classics like Chardonnay and Pinot Noir, alongside lesser-known grapes grown in England like Bacchus.

What are biodynamic wines?

Open tab

Biodynamic wines go beyond organic farming. They view the vineyard as a living organism and consider the influence of lunar cycles and other cosmic factors on grape growth. Biodynamic practices aim to promote biodiversity and soil health, ultimately leading to a more natural and expressive wine, whilst fostering the land back to its full potential.

Where is Tillingham Winery located?

Open tab

Tillingham Winery is nestled in a secluded corner of the Sussex countryside in Peasmarsh, East Sussex, England.

What kind of wines does Tillingham produce?

Open tab

Tillingham offers a diverse selection of wines, including classics and lesser-known varieties such as Bacchus and Ortega.

They also grow multiple grape varieties together, undergo a co-fermenting process which results in a complex and layered flavour profile.
